Understanding Chronic Discomfort
Enduring pain is a disorder that continues for extended periods, lengthy durations, or even years, often impacting daily routines and total quality of life. Unlike sharp pain, which serves as a alert for injury or disease, chronic pain may occur absent of an clear cause. It can manifest in diverse shapes, including but not confined to arthritis, fibromyalgia, and neuropathic pain. Patients may experience shooting, burning, or aching sensations that can vary in intensity and duration. Grasping this intricacy is essential for successful chronic pain treatment.
The impact of chronic pain extends further than physical pain; it can impact emotional and psychological well-being. Many people dealing with chronic pain document feelings of anxiety, depression, and isolation, which can worsen their situation. As a consequence, an comprehensive approach to pain management is necessary. Combining physical treatments with psychological support aids address the complex nature of chronic pain, encouraging a holistic pathway to recovery.

Healing Strategies to Pain Relief
Persistent pain therapy encompasses multiple healing strategies designed to ease pain and boost the well-being for patients suffering from ongoing pain. These methods go above basic medication use, centering on tackling the root causes and supporting patients regain their ability. Physical therapy, for instance, is a vital component in treating chronic pain, as it offers focused exercises and techniques that build muscles and enhance mobility. A skilled physical therapist can adapt a program to satisfy individual needs, fostering better posture and lessening strain on targeted areas.
An additional successful method for pain management involves cognitive behavioral therapy, that tackles the psychological aspects of chronic pain. This approach helps patients formulate coping strategies, addressing negative thought patterns linked to their pain experience. By fostering a better comprehension of the pain’s impact on mental health, people can learn to handle their responses more effectively, which can bring about a decrease in perceived pain. This dual focus on emotional and physical health is vital for a integrated approach to chronic pain therapy.
Holistic techniques such as acupuncture and massage therapy can also have a significant role in pain relief. Such practices encourage the body's natural healing processes and encourage relaxation, reducing tension in muscles and encouraging blood flow to painful areas. Many patients claim improvements in their symptoms and overall well-being when incorporating these treatments into their chronic pain management plans.
